/SAPAPO/ATP_BOP005 - Details

  • The SAP error message /SAPAPO/ATP_BOP005 Filter type &1 does not exist typically occurs in the context of Advanced Planning and Optimization (APO) when the system is trying to access a filter type that has not been defined or is not available in the system.
    
    Cause: Missing Filter Definition: The specified filter type (represented by &1 in the error message) has not been created or is not available in the system.
    Configuration Issues: There may be issues with the configuration settings in the APO system that prevent the filter type from being recognized. Transport Issues: If the filter type was recently transported from another system, it may not have been transported correctly or may not exist in the target system. Authorization Issues: The user may not have the necessary authorizations to access the filter type.
